The inspiration of the series comes from the in-depth observation and experience of Miao costumes, as well as the emotional connection with my hometown in southwestern Hunan. My hometown is southwestern Hunan, where the people are simple and honest, surrounded by mountains, and there are gathering places of different ethnic groups around, such as the Dong, Yao, Miao, etc. Different ethnic groups and cultures blend here, forming a unique landscape and atmosphere. Streams, caves, mountains and flowers are my childhood memories of my hometown. In the process of returning to my hometown, I felt deeply sorry that many fields were abandoned because most young people went out to work, and the clear and bright streams in my childhood have now become dry wastelands, and the waterfalls are gone forever. Through the study of the structure and craftsmanship of Miao costumes, the characteristics of the shape structure, color pattern and production process of Miao costumes are integrated into the work "Miao" for application and practice, realizing the application of the structure and craftsmanship of Miao costumes in modern clothing. The clothing features of the Miao ethnic group, its silhouette, cutting, color matching and craftsmanship can make modern clothing more comfortable and personalized, reflecting the reference value of Miao clothing elements for modern clothing design.

In terms of color, the blue and black colors commonly used by the Miao people are used. Through the combination of modern fabric digital printing and tie-dye colors, and the innovation of embroidery patterns based on the arrangement and combination of Miao abstract patterns, the clothing looks both color-balanced and unique to the Miao people, which is in line with the current fashion trend. The work also experimentally uses modern technology and methods to achieve the effect of traditional handicrafts. By innovatively integrating the modern technology of machine pleating, the traditional Miao hand-made pleated craftsmanship effect is achieved, improving efficiency while maintaining the beauty and refinement of traditional craftsmanship.
